Tuesday 14th September 2010
Meteosat 8 satellite picture from Ferdinand Valk’s site at 12.00 UTC http://www.fvalk.com/images/Day_image/MSG-1200-EUR.jpg Meteosat MSG-2 satellite picture from Bernard Burton’s site at 12.00 UTC http://www.woksat.info/etcsi14m/si14-msg-1200-uk.html NOAA 19 satellite picture from Bernard Burton’s site at 12.02 UTC http://www.woksat.info/etcsi14/si14-1202-b-uk.html Cold front over the southern half of Britain. Showers over Ireland, Scotland and NW England. Frontal cloud over the NW half of Belgium; high and medium-level cloud over the SE half. UK min. temps on Monday night http://tinyurl.com/3xfwts3 Lusa (Skye) and Aviemore 9.7°C, Baltasound, Lerwick and Tulloch Bridge 9.5°C, Kirkwall and Wick 9.1°C, Altnaharra and Glen Ogle 8.9°C, Stornoway 8.7°C, Loch Glascarnoch 8.5°C. Leeming and Linton-on-Ouse 16.7°C, Hawarden 16.8°C, Crosby 16.9°C, Topcliffe 17.5°C. UK max. temps on Tuesday http://tinyurl.com/3ysr2op Glen Ogle 8.8°C, Loch Glascarnoch 10.1°C, Lerwick 10.5°C, Kirkwall 11.9°C, Stornoway and Tulloch Bridge 12.2°C. Weybourne, Heathrow and Gravesend 20.1°C, Holbeach and Marham 20.2°C, Bridlington 20.3°C, Scampton and Wainfleet 20.5°C, Wittering 20.6°C, Yeovilton 20.9°C, Coningsby 21.1°C, Donna Nook 21.5°C. OGIMET summary http://tinyurl.com/39hss5k Rainfall radar http://www.meteox.com/h.aspx?r=&soort=loop24uur&URL or http://www.raintoday.co.uk/ Cold front with outbreaks of rain moves south over southern Britain on Tuesday. Widespread showers over northern Britain. Thunder in places in Scotland. Rainfall totals in 24 hours ending 18.00 UTC on Tuesday http://tinyurl.com/356bhfl Crosby and St Bees Head 12 mm, Shap 13 mm, Sennybridge 14 mm, Keswick 18 mm, Lerwick 19 mm, Loch Glascarnoch and Trawsgoed 20 mm, Liscombe 24 mm, Lake Vyrnwy 32 mm, Capel Curig 45 mm.
